This build centres on the legendary Blasphemous Blade, a colossal greatsword with the unique skill Taker’s Flames. This skill is a game-changer, spewing a wave of fire that deals massive damage and, most importantly, heals you with every hit.
It’s the ultimate tool for both offence and defence. By focusing on Faith, Strength, and Vigor, you’ll be an unstoppable fire-spewing tank, able to clear entire groups of enemies and outlast bosses with ease. It’ll take some effort to get the blade, but it’s worth it.

While its reign as the undisputed king of PvP may have waned, the Rivers of Blood katana is still an absolute menace in PvE. Corpse Piler is a flurry of bloody slashes that inflict massive bleed buildup and lots of damage on its own, shredding through enemy health bars – especially against bosses who can be bled.
This build capitalises on a ton of bleeding, so pairing the katana with the White Mask helm and Lord of Blood’s Exultation talisman to maximise its damage output is the way to go. Both pieces of equipment will increase your damage when there’s bleeding nearby, even on enemies, so your damage will be through the roof.

For those who prefer a more magical approach, the Night Comet build is all about staying at a safe distance and dishing out insane damage. The Night Comet sorcery is an incredibly potent spell that is hard for many enemies and bosses to dodge, though it does have a hefty 38 Intelligence requirement. You’ll need to be slinging pebbles until you reach this.
By wielding the Staff of Loss and stacking Intelligence, you become a long-range glass cannon, capable of deleting enemies before they even get close. Get your hands on a second Staff of Loss, though, and you become a weapon of mass disintegration.

Twinblades are a personal favourite of mine in Elden Ring, thanks to how elegant they are to use and how effective they slay enemies. This gets turned up to eleven when dual-wielding them and letting power stance fly.
By infusing one twinblade with a Poison Ash of War and the other with Seppuku, you create a perfect storm of debuffs. This build thrives on constant pressure and a flurry of jump attacks, which quickly stack both status effects and melt enemy health bars.
I’d personally recommend that you make one of your twinblades the Godskin Peeler. Black Flame Tornado is just too fun a weapon skill to pass up.
Pure Strength, Nothing But Strength, All Strength Build
Sometimes, the simplest approach can be the most effective. Equip a massive weapon like the Giant-Crusher or Greatsword, put on the heaviest armour you can find, and invest everything into Strength, Vigor, and Endurance.
The raw damage and stagger potential of these weapons is unmatched, turning you into an unstoppable force of nature. It might take some serious practice to get to grips with some bosses, but the retaliatory pain you can lay out in return is so, so satisfying.

Combining the power of Faith with the speed of a Katana or Great Scythe creates a build that’s as fast as it is lethal. The Lightning Faith hybrid build leverages incantations like Lightning Spear and Honed Bolt for ranged damage, while also using the Electrify Armament incantation to coat your weapon in lightning.
The result is a highly mobile character that can deal both devastating close-range and long-range damage, perfect for any situation.

This build revolves around the Sword of St. Trina for inflicting Sleep and a weapon with a Frost affinity (like a handy light sword with the Chilling Mist Ash of War) to trigger Frostbite. You can put enemies to sleep with St. Trina’s Sword, then land a critical hit while they’re vulnerable.
Afterwards, a few quick hits from your frost weapon will trigger Frostbite, dealing a burst of damage and making the enemy take more damage from subsequent hits. This constant cycle of debuffs gives you complete control over any battle and makes you feel incredibly powerful.
Sleep is useless against many of the game’s most difficult foes; this might be a build best suited to flexing your skills in PvP over PvE.
